Abstract
90 alcoholic patients (II stage of alcoholism) with secondary affectiv e disorders (anxiety, depression) were divided into 4 groups. The pati ents of the first group received the GABA receptor ligand baclofen dur ing 3 weeks. Sybazon preparation was used in the second group, while t he patients of the third group were treated with amitriptyline. Placeb o was applied in the forth group. The clinical psychological tests dem onstrated that all drugs caused quite effective relief of affective di sorders. Psychosemantic tests application showed that the pharmacother apy caused positive changes in patients of 1 - 3 groups. These changes touched on both system of personal estimations and relations of perso nality to himself and to the world around i.e. psychosemantic sphere. Such changes in psychosemantic sphere were not observed in the 4-th gr oup of patients (placebo). Besides it was revealed that each drug caus ed some specific changes in psychosemantic sphere. The result obtained were supposed to have some theoretical value in comprehension of brai n-psychics relations as well as the applied significance for adequate choice of affective disorders pharmacotherapy of alcoholic patients.
